How Long Does AC Installation Take? (Complete Timeline for 2026)
A central AC installation typically takes 4–8 hours for a straight replacement and 1–3 days for a new system with ductwork. Here's exactly what happens at each stage, what can slow things down, and how to prepare so your installation goes smoothly.
